CONSTRUCTION  
The resistors are constructed out of a high-grade ceramic  
body. Internal metal electrodes are added at each end and  
connected by a resistive layer. The resistive layer is adjusted  
to give the approximate required resistance and laser cutting  
of this resistive layer that achieves tolerance trims the value.  
The resistive layer is covered with a protective coat and  
printed with the resistance value. Finally, the two external  
terminations (matte tin) are added. See fig. 5.

FUNCTIONAL DESCRIPTION  
POWER RATING  
Each type rated power at 70°C:  
RE0201=1/20W, RE0402=1/16W, RE0603=1/10W,  
RE0805=1/8 W, RE1206=1/4W  
RATED VOLTAGE  
The DC or AC (rms) continuous working voltage  
corresponding to the rated power is determined by  
the following formula:  
V=(P X R)  
or max. working voltage whichever is less
